Output dd8e18b52e51fa19db3a9e323df80a1ef7c86a7bc391ec990b4e0428706071ae:0

value
2213999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69bdc2f6571ed71867fd1a67ce0781f856006b2a OP_EQUAL
address
3BL8CYv4PAH5oc1Tj1rWwK2e46Ld16Yb6p
transaction
dd8e18b52e51fa19db3a9e323df80a1ef7c86a7bc391ec990b4e0428706071ae
spent
true